Address 0 PPC

PDbRsMicm2gTmsoHjyxq4dguX4baRDhQmj

Confirmed

Total Received256.665782 PPC
Total Sent256.665782 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PLD1b9er9cC6honqebCu5SQCTPMtaSRf6V99.98 PPC
PDbRsMicm2gTmsoHjyxq4dguX4baRDhQmj256.665782 PPC
Fee: 0.01 PPC
409327 Confirmations356.635782 PPC
PDbRsMicm2gTmsoHjyxq4dguX4baRDhQmj256.665782 PPC
PKAzdwb1wussUD6ubLhTpWsxXJjC1geSb750 PPC ×
Fee: 0.01 PPC
409328 Confirmations306.665782 PPC